The ingredients needed to make Potato Mochi:
  1. Get 2 medium Potatoes *about 300g, OR 1 cup Mashed Potatoes
  2. Prepare Salt for cooking Potatoes
  3. Take 1 tablespoon Cold Water
  4. Prepare 1/4 cup Glutinous Rice Flour
  5. Make ready Extra 3 to 4 tablespoons Glutinous Rice Flour
  6. Make ready <Optional Ingredients>
  7. Make ready Oil for cooking
  8. Make ready 1 tablespoons Soy Sauce
  9. Prepare 1 teaspoon Sugar
  10. Prepare Chilli Powder
  11. Prepare Nori (Seaweed Sheet)

Steps to make Potato Mochi:
  1. Cook Potatoes in the boiling slated water until tender. Drain and mash until smooth, then add Cold Water and mix well.
  2. Add 1/4 cup Glutenous Rice Flour and mix well. Then add extra Glutenous Rice Flour gradually, and mix well. Form the mixture into balls or discs.
  3. Cook in a lightly oiled frying pan over low heat until both sides are browned. If the edges are not well cooked, add 2 to 3 tablespoons Water and cover with a lid to steam cook. When cooked, drizzle over with the mixture of Soy Sauce, Sugar and Chilli Powder, turn Mochi cakes over and coat them evenly.
  4. For soup, cook in the boiling salted OR unsalted water, and add to the soup.
